Isaac Hayes Remembered on VH1

To honor the memory of soul superstar Isaac Hayes, VH1 Classic and VH1 Soul will air The Golden Globe nominated documentary “Wattstax” on Wednesday at 8 p.m.
Filmmaker Mel Stuart captured the August 20, 1972 Wattstax music festival known as “the black Woodstock” at the Los Angeles Memorial Coliseum in this documentary.
Memphis’s Stax Records commemorated the seventh anniversary of the Watts riots with this festival featuring powerful performances by Hayes, Albert King, Rufus and Carla Thomas, the Staple Singers, the Emotions, the Bar-Kays, as well as a comic routine from an up-and-coming comedian named Richard Pryor.
